Fmoc-L-glutamic acid α-allyl ester
Allyl esters are useful carboxy protecting groups in the synthesis of various cyclic peptides glycopeptides. Allyl esters are cleaved quantitatively under mild conditions using Pd(0) catalyst. Fmoc-L-glutamic acid g -2-phenylisopropyl ester
The 2-PhiPr group can be removed selectively in the presence of tBu-based protecting groups by treatment with 1% TFA in DCM, making this derivative an extremely useful tool for the preparation of cyclic peptides by Fmoc SPPS. Fmoc-Glu(O-2-PhiPr)-OH
Quasi-orthogonally-protected Glu derivative. The 2-PhiPr group can be removed selectively in the presence of tBu-based protecting groups by treatment with 1% TFA in DCM , making this derivative an extremely useful tool for the preparation of cyclic peptides by Fmoc SPPS. or for library synthesis. For the on-resin synthesis of side-chain to side-chain lactam bridged peptides, the combination of Lys(Mtt) and Glu(O-2-PhiPr) is particularly advantageous since both side-chains can be simultaneously unmasked in a single step. Fmoc-Glu-OAll
Orthogonally-protected building block for the synthesis of head-to-tail cyclic peptides by Fmoc SPPS.The α-allyl ester can be selectively removed in the presence of Fmoc- and tBu-based protecting groups by treatment with Pd(Ph3P)4/ CHCl3/AcOH/NMM, thereby facilitating the synthesis of branched esters and amides, and lactones and lactams incorporating a glutamyl unit. Fmoc-Glu-ODmab
Quasi-orthogonally-protected Glu derivative. The Dmab group can be removed selectively in the presence of tBu-based protecting groups by treatment with 2% hydrazine in DMF , making this derivative an extremely useful tool for the preparation of cyclic peptides by Fmoc SPPS. or for library synthesis. For the on-resin synthesis of side-chain to side-chain lactam bridged peptides, the combination of Lys(ivDde) and Glu(ODmab) is particularly advantageous since both side-chains can be simultaneously unmasked in a single step. Fmoc-Glu-OtBu
Selectively protected building block for library synthesis or the preparation of γ-glutamyl peptides by Fmoc SPPS. After condensation of the side-chain carboxy with an appropriate amine or alcohol, the γ-amino and carboxy functions can be selectively unmasked with 20% piperidine in DMF and 50% TFA in DCM respectively, facilitating the synthesis of branched esters, amides, lactams and lactones containing the glutamyl unit.
